For more than a year, I’ve owned Grand Theft Auto 5 on my computer, and it has recently ceased functioning. I'm unsure of the cause. When I attempt to open the game, it loads but then gets stuck at a block displaying “unable to launch GTA 5, verify game files and data.” I performed this action, and Steam indicated that all files were legitimate; however, I continued to receive the same error message. Does anyone have any suggestions for resolving this issue?
